Discover the grape variety: Zlatarica Vrgorska

Lively, fresh dry whites with a pale golden colour and a lean, crisp palate; signature aromas of citrus (lemon, grapefruit), white flowers and Dalmatian herbal notes. Refreshing style, drink young. Preserved for its heritage value, used in small-batch artisan Croatian cuvées around Vrgorac in inland Dalmatia. Very rare indigenous Croatian white grape, studied for its Adriatic genetic interest.

The wine region of Zurichsee

Wine region of German-speaking Switzerland around Lake Zurich, south-facing slopes on moraines, molasse and schists. Signature Pinot Noir (Blauburgunder) as king red: fine and silky with red cherry, raspberry, underbrush, dried flowers and spices, fine tannins and elegant palate — among the best in German Switzerland. Räuschling native local specialty (lake vine): lively mineral white. Supple Müller-Thurgau, ample Chardonnay, aromatic Gewürztraminer.


The wine region of Zürich

Largest German-speaking wine canton of Switzerland, 620 ha around the lake. Star Pinot Noir (Blauburgunder): fine, fresh reds with notes of cherry, raspberry, undergrowth and sweet spices, silky tannins and a delicate style. Also light, floral Müller-Thurgau and precise Chardonnay. A unique speciality: Räuschling, a rare native white almost exclusive to the canton ("vine of the lake"), lively with citrus, white flowers and taut minerality.

The word of the wine: Blanc de blancs (champagne)

Champagne made only from the Chardonnay grape. The expression has been somewhat overused by the intensive use made of it by certain large distributors of white table wines (or sparkling wines) who were thus seeking to promote their product.
